ソーシャル メディア アプリケーションは、人々を結び付け、情報を提供し、楽しませる現代のデジタル ライフに不可欠な部分です。アプリケーションを安定して実行し、迅速に応答し続けるためには、継続的インテグレーションおよびデリバリー (CI/CD) プロセスが重要であり、PHP フレームワークはこれらのプロセスを実装するための効果的なツールです。
継続的インテグレーションは、コードの変更を共有リポジトリに頻繁にマージすることで問題の早期検出を促進するソフトウェア開発手法です。継続的デリバリーはこれを拡張したもので、自動展開を通じて新しい機能を迅速かつ確実にユーザーに提供します。
PHP フレームワークは、ルーティング、テンプレート、検証などの一般的なタスク用に事前に構築されたコンポーネントを提供します。 CI/CD 環境では、ビルド、テスト、デプロイなどの主要なプロセスを自動化できます。
PHP フレームワークは、次のプロセスを自動化することで CI/CD の効率を向上させることができます。
「SocialConnect」という名前のソーシャル メディア アプリケーションを例にとると、CI/CD 構成には次のものが含まれます。
開発者がコードを Git リポジトリに送信すると、Jenkins はビルドとテストのプロセスを自動的にトリガーします。テストに合格すると、Capistrano は変更を実稼働環境にデプロイし、完全に自動化して、迅速でエラーのないリリースを保証します。
PHP フレームワークは、CI/CD の自動化ツールであるだけでなく、次の方法でアプリケーションの品質を向上させることもできます。
PHP フレームワークを使用して、ソーシャル メディア アプリケーション用の効率的な CI/CD プロセスを構築します。 PHP フレームワークは、プロセスを自動化し、品質を向上させることで、アプリケーションの安定性、パフォーマンス、継続的なイノベーションを保証します。